ENS 5613330 September 2022 14:19:00The following information was obtained from the licensee in accordance with Headquarters Operations Officers Report Guidance: On September 29, 2022, a patient was administered an I-131 treatment to the thyroid. The patient did not receive the additional administration of Thyrogen, a hormone meant to enhance the uptake of I-131 to the thyroid. This resulted in dose delivered to other areas of the body and an underdose to the thyroid of preliminarily greater than 20 percent. Additional preliminary calculations showed that the bladder received approximately 17 Rem and the patient received a whole body dose of 39 Rem. A Medical Event may indicate potential problems in a medical facility's use of radioactive materials. It does not necessarily result in harm to the patient.
